Couldn't connect to the bethesda.net servers (Trying reinstalling the game already) every time i try to download the creation club content, ...To link your Xbox account to your Bethesda.net, open your Skyrim or Fallout 4 game and select Mods from the main menu. From there, you will be prompted to log into your Bethesda.net account. Once complete, your Bethesda.net account will be linked to your Xbox account and you will be able to add and remove mods from your in-game mod library ... The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im Special Edition > General Discussions > Topic Details. Date Posted: Dec 18, 2016 @ 10:28am.Check Bethesda.net Status. You can check the Bethesda.net Server Status page here. If an outage is reported, you will not be able to play until it is resolved. Switch to Wired Connection. If you are trying to play The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im on a wireless connection, try switching to wired connection instead and see if there is any improvement.Check the Bethesda.net Status page to see if there are any issues. Check the Bethesda Support Twitter account to see if there are any planned maintenances or outages. Run a network connection test. Instructions on how to do so can be found here for PlayStation 4 and here for Xbox One.Check the Bethesda Support Twitter account to see if there are any planned maintenances or outages. I give him the statue and got only 150gold then he suddenly ask me for some gold like nothing happened. 2.3K. 117.Go on Bethesda’s support website, choose Skyrim, submit a ticket of your connection issue. Mark to be contacted through either email or text (text is faster). You will be asked if you want to unlink your Xbox account from Bethesda.net, say yes and they will unlink your account. Then go onto Bethesda.net, go to linked accounts, re-link/sign ... DanUnbreakable • 1 yr. ago. Go to the site on your phone or computer, login in and link your Xbox account. Then go to your Xbox, open Skyrim, and hit mods. It should log you in. I had to do this recently. I linked both my Xbox and playstation accounts to my Bethesda account.
